Aluminium Windows

Aluminium windows are a popular option for homeowners who want to improve their homes. They are available in different styles and can be made to fit almost any design vision. They are also eco-friendly and can reduce your carbon footprint.

Aesthetically, aluminium frames are often more pleasing to the eye than other types of windows. They feature slim frames and are available in multiple colors.

They are also very long-lasting and can last for years. They can be powder-coated with many different finishes and can be easily cleaned. They can be kept in good shape by a quick clean every couple of months.

Aluminium tilt turn windows can also be used as doors. They can also be fitted with tiles to open at an angle or open wide like doors. They are ideal for letting air flow into your home, and are also very easy to clean.

Aluminium windows also have an energy efficiency benefit. Aluminium windows can help you save money by keeping your home cool, and heating your home less.

In contrast to uPVC frames, aluminium frames can be painted to match the color of your home. This makes them a good alternative for homes built with traditional exteriors.

In addition, they are ideal for homes with contemporary designs. They can make your Maidstone home look more chic and modern.

They are a popular choice for houses across the nation. They are also very durable and can be a great investment for your home. They can also be recycled which is a great option to help the environment.

Timber Windows

Wooden windows can bring a house together with natural beauty that will last for generations. They can be stained, carved or painted to match the design of the home and will fit any style of property.

They are also more sustainable as they are less likely to rot and require minimal maintenance. They can also reduce heating costs making them a cost-effective choice for UK homeowners.

Maidstone Windows and doors offers high-performance timber windows for replacement windows. These windows can be constructed of a variety of different kinds of wood like mahogany or maple, so you can select the style that suits your home's style best.

They are also extremely robust and can withstand lots of wear and tear over the years. They are also extremely energy efficient, which will aid in saving money on your electric bills.

As a building material, timber is naturally insulating and can lower your electric bill because it keeps the heat inside your home. This is important to homeowners, particularly when it comes to decreasing your carbon footprint and lowering the emissions that are being produced by the electric power you use in your home.
